Clem Parks It At Hendry County

CLEWISTON, Fla. — If you like your racing polite, Hendry County wasn’t your scene on Saturday night.

Eighteen 360 winged warriors rolled into Hendry County Motorsports Park, and from the second the green flag snapped, it turned into a bare-knuckle brawl on clay.

Up front, it was game on early between P.J. Reutimann and Tyler Clem — two heavy hitters trading shots, sliders, and inches like neither one planned on lifting. The cushion was the playground, the bottom was a gamble, and the air was thick with dirt and bad intentions.

Clem, starting third, kept his cool while chaos brewed behind him.

When it mattered, he pulled the trigger, took control, and never looked back — parking it in victory lane and backing up his fast time from earlier in the night.

While Clem sealed the deal up front, Jacksonville Beach’s Matt Kurtz went full send through the field.

Starting 13th, Kurtz picked them off one by one like a man on a mission, charging to a hard-earned second and the biggest mover of the night.

Reutimann stayed in the fight all race long, but after that early slugfest, he had to settle for third.

Austin Martin and Luke Hill rounded out the top five, both steady, both fast, both right there when it counted.
